Getting to Know the Bolognese

The Bolognese is a small, fluffy dog that originated in Italy. Known for their cheerful and affectionate nature, Bolognese dogs are excellent companions for families and individuals alike. They are known for their intelligence and eagerness to please, making them easy to train and well-behaved in various situations.

These dogs have a charming personality and are known for their loyalty and devotion to their owners. They are often described as velcro dogs because they love to be by their owner's side at all times. Bolognese dogs are also great with children and other pets, making them an ideal choice for families with multiple animals.

Introducing the Bavarian Mountain Scent Hound

The Bavarian Mountain Scent Hound, on the other hand, is a medium-sized dog that was originally bred for hunting in the Bavarian region of Germany. This breed is known for its incredible sense of smell and tracking abilities, making them popular among hunters and search and rescue teams.

Despite their hunting background, Bavarian Mountain Scent Hounds are also known for their friendly and sociable nature. They are loyal and affectionate towards their owners, but they can also be independent and stubborn at times. These dogs require plenty of exercise and mental stimulation to keep them happy and healthy.
